OPERATIONS

On Consolidated Basis:

The Company has Rs. 8,75,68,51,000.00 income in the current year as compared to Rs.4,92,91,66,000.00 in the previous year. The Net Profit for the year under review amounted to Rs. 80,27,09,000.00 in the current year as compared to Rs. 37,02,93,000.00 in the previous year.

On Standalone Basis:

The Company has Rs. 6,73,07,56,000.00 income in the current year as compared to Rs.3,82,78,58,000.00 in the previous year. The Net Profit for the year under review amounted to Rs. 74,36,84,000.00 in the current year as compared to 34,22,75,000.00 in the previous year.

 
TRANSFER TO RESERVES

On Consolidated Basis:

During the year under review, your Company has transferred Rs. 80,27,09,000.00 amount to Reserves of the company.

On Standalone Basis:

During the year under the review, your Company has transferred Rs. 74,36,84,000.00 amount to Reserves of the company

DIVIDEND

For strengthening the net worth of the Company and to pursue larger projects, the available surplus is retained and hence your Directors do not recommend payment of Dividend on Equity Share Capital for the Financial Year 2022-2023.

2. There was Bonus Issue in the Company and the same was approved by the board on 08th December, 2022 and the following resolution was passed:
ISSUE AND ALLOTMENT OF BONUS SHARES:
The Chairman Informed the Board that in the Extraordinary General Meeting held on 07th December, 2022 the issue of bonus shares was approved by the Shareholders.

It was proposed that the Subscribed Share Capital of the Company will be increased by allotment of Bonus Shares in the ratio of 16:1 this will bring the Subscribed Share Capital from existing Rs. 3,00,00,000 to Rs. 48,00,00,000 this will be from the General reserves of the Company.

After discussion, the Board unanimously passed the following resolution.

“RESOLVED THAT in pursuant to the provisions of Section 63 of the Companies Act, 2013, Rules made thereunder and in accordance with provisions of Articles of Association of the Company, (including any statutory modification or enactment thereof, for the time being in force) and pursuant to authority given by the Shareholders at its Extraordinary General Meeting held on 07th December, 2022, the issue and allotment of 4,80,00,000 Equity Shares of Rs.10/- each amount to Rs. 48,00,00,000/- in the form of bonus shares in the ratio of 16:1 (16 Bonus Share for every 1 share held) by capitalization of Reserves to existing Shareholders as on date of this meeting, and as per the allotment of Bonus Shares placed before this meeting, be and is hereby approved.”

PREVENTION OF SEXUAL HARASSMENT POLICY:

The Company has in place a Prevention of Sexual Harassment policy in line with the requirements of the Sexual Harassment of Women at the Workplace (Prevention, Prohibition and Redressal) Act, 2013. An Internal Complaints Committee has been set up to redress complaints received regarding sexual harassment. All employees (permanent, contractual, temporary, trainees) are covered under this policy.
During the year 2022-2023, no complaints were received by the Company related to sexual harassment.

STATUTORY AUDITORS

KAILASH CHAND JAIN & CO., Chartered Accountants, (FRN:-112318W) will be appointed as Statutory Auditors for a period of five years in the Annual General Meeting to be held on 30/09/2023.

During the year under review the existing statutory Auditors of the Company M/s R.R Mamidwar & Co., Chartered Accountants, has tendered their resignation and due to which the casual vacancy has been created, which has been fulfilled by the Members of the Company at the extraordinary general meeting and has appointed M/s KAILASH CHAND JAIN & CO., Chartered Accountants, Chartered Accountants for the financial year 2022-2023.
